LEWISTON – A Lewiston Veterinary Hospital employee was recently licensed by the state as a veterinary technician.

Shannon Roy of Lewiston passed the Maine Board of Veterinary Medicine licensing exam and was awarded certification in February.

As a registered technician, she is licensed to induce anesthesia, perform dental work, assist in surgery, draw blood and administer intravenous fluids as well as conduct radiologic exams and other nursing duties.

Roy, a native of Caswell, joined the Lewiston practice in July after working in animal care in Leicester, Mass., and at the Presque Isle Animal Hospital in Presque Isle.

She received an associate degree in veterinary technology from Becker College in Leicester, Mass., in 2003.

The Lewiston Veterinary Hospital at 75 Stetson Road has a staff of six licensed veterinary technicians and four licensed veterinarians.
